On 2020/2/25 7:47, Marc Zyngier wrote: > Hi Zenghui, > > On 2020-02-24 02:50, Zenghui Yu wrote: >> The Valid bit must be cleared before changing anything else when writing >> GICR_VPENDBASER to avoid the UNPREDICTABLE behavior. This is exactly what >> we've done on 32bit arm, but not on arm64. > > I'm not quite sure how you decide that Valid must be cleared before > changing > anything else. The reason why we do it on 32bit is that we cannot update > the full 64bit register at once, so we start by clearing Valid so that > we can update the rest. arm64 doesn't require that.
The problem came out from discussions with our GIC engineers and what we talked about at that time was IHI 0069E 9.11.36 - the description of the Valid field:
"Writing a new value to any bit of GICR_VPENDBASER, other than GICR_VPENDBASER.Valid, when GICR_VPENDBASER.Valid==1 is UNPREDICTABLE."
It looks like we should first clear the Valid and then write something else. We might have some mis-understanding about this statement..
> > For the rest of discussion, let's ignore GICv4.1 32bit support (I'm > pretty sure nobody cares about that). > >> This works fine on GICv4 where we only clear Valid for a vPE deschedule. >> With the introduction of GICv4.1, we might also need to talk something >> else >> (e.g., PendingLast, Doorbell) to the redistributor when clearing the >> Valid. >> Let's port the 32bit gicr_write_vpendbaser() to arm64 so that hardware >> can >> do the right thing after descheduling the vPE. > > The spec says that: > > "For a write that writes GICR_VPENDBASER.Valid from 1 to 0, if > GICR_VPENDBASER.PendingLast is written as 1 then > GICR_VPENDBASER.PendingLast > takes an UNKNOWN value and GICR_VPENDBASER.Doorbell is treated as being 0." > > and > > "When GICR_VPENDBASER.Valid is written from 1 to 0, if there are > outstanding > enabled pending interrupts GICR_VPENDBASER.Doorbell is treated as 0." > > which indicate that PendingLast/Doorbell have to be written at the same > time > as we clear Valid.
Yes. I obviously missed these two points when writing this patch.
> Can you point me to the bit of the v4.1 spec that makes > this "clear Valid before doing anything else" requirement explicit?
No, nothing in v4.1 spec supports me :-( The above has been forwarded to Hisilicon and I will confirm these with them. It would be easy for hardware to handle the PendingLast/DB when clearing Valid, I think.
